The main element dilemma of ultraviolet coherent light-weight source primarily focuses on the development of nonlinear optical frequency conversion crystal in ultraviolet band. The nonlinear optical crystal is amongst the ailments for frequency transformation, so The expansion, size, hurt resistance, conversion effectiveness and allowable parameter number of nonlinear optical crystal are essential more and more.
On the flip side, the beam high-quality of the larger ability DUV laser would turn into worse as a result of more really serious thermal and nonlinear results. Hence, the frequency conversion processes should be thoroughly intended to mitigate the aforementioned results. Thus, a substantial-power DUV laser in the FHG of 1 μm with a fantastic beam high-quality might be acquired and will be useful for acquiring the shorter wavelength DUV lasers for instance 193 nm by SFG.

Its UV absorption edge reaches one hundred eighty nm. The powerful nonlinear optical coefficient of CLBO for frequency doubling at 1064nm is about twice as significant as that of KDP. CLBO crystals could be developed in the stoichiometric melt with lessen viscosity.
The event of the 193-nm laser was demonstrated by levels of SFG. So as to scale the DUV laser electrical power effectively, a different idea of your 193-nm DUV laser generation is introduced according to the diamond Raman laser.
